¿Cómo puedo concatenar dos campos en una vista?

15

Tengo una vista configurada para usar el tipo de lista sin formato. Extraigo unos 10 campos diferentes, pero me gustaría concatenar dos de ellos en una sola línea en la pantalla. es posible?

Ejemplo: los campos son Contenido: Número de sesión, Contenido: Título, Contenido: Fecha y hora, Contenido: Altavoz. En este momento, todos ellos se representan en líneas separadas. Me gustaría que el Número de sesión y el Título se concatenen en una sola línea, así que obtengo S3 | El título de mi sesión.

EmmyS
fuente
esto también se puede hacer usando la configuración de campos en la pestaña Formato, vea Campos: Configuración , después de hacer clic en esto verá una ventana emergente, ahora simplemente verifique los campos en la opción en línea .
WaQaR Ali

Respuestas:

28

Digamos que tiene el campo A y el campo B.

  1. Asegúrese de que A aparezca antes que B en la lista de campos.
  2. Edite el campo A y marque "Excluir de la pantalla". El campo ya no aparecerá.
  3. Edite el campo B, busque la casilla de verificación "Reescribir la salida de este campo".
  4. Debajo del nuevo cuadro de texto, busque "Patrones de reemplazo". Allí debería poder encontrar algo que se parezca a [campo-A] y [campo-B], con posiblemente muchas más opciones.
  5. Ingrese "[campo-A] [campo-B]" como patrón de reemplazo.

Y deberías tener los campos concatenados.

Hay alguna situación en la que no es deseable el marcado generado por las Vistas con esta configuración, ya que ahora tendrá A "dentro" de B. Si eso es un problema, se puede agregar un campo ficticio completamente nuevo, de tipo "Global: texto" y a los pasos 3, 4 y 5 en ese campo en su lugar.

Letharion
fuente
2
Sí, he encontrado que es más comprensible excluir tanto el campo A como el B, y usar un nuevo campo ficticio para concatenarlos juntos.
Johnathan Elmore
Pregunta positiva de +1 y esta respuesta - cosas geniales - También encontré que esto funciona. Y si desea que el campo resultante sea enlazable, puede usar Content: Path y usar esto como un token en Global: configuración de reescritura del campo de texto.
therobyouknow
@Letharion ¿Cómo se pueden concatenar dos archivos y mostrarlos en el nodo?
Yama